Technical Support Specialist

Company:  KARL STORZ
Location: Mississauga
Closing Date: 29/10/2024
Hours: Full Time
Type: Permanent
Job Requirements / Description
SUMMARY OF POSITIONThe Technical Support Specialist will drive customer satisfaction throughout the lifespan of KARL STORZ medical devices, from installation to end-of-support, through the depot and on-site service delivery, which will include technical support, equipment evaluation, preventative maintenance, corrective service, and installation of KARL STORZ medical instrumentation and OR1® integrated Operating Rooms.They will work in tandem with Account Executives and Regional Sales Managers to promote repair, exchange and preventative maintenance service programs.RESPONSIBILITIESEffective use of technical knowledge and experience to evaluate, troubleshoot, repair, calibrate, and complete quality performance and testing procedures on KARL STORZ Medical Equipment.Use of SAP ERP system for various Technical service practices and data entry.Perform StayReady visits at customer sites to evaluate, inspect, troubleshoot, repair, calibrate, and complete quality performance and testing procedures on assigned equipment.Preparation and inspection of medical equipment for customer demonstration, loaners, and/or conferences.Installation of equipment at customer sites and/or conferences including support and installation of OR1® integrated Operating Rooms.Perform regular preventative maintenance on KARL STORZ OR1® integrated Operating Rooms, video towers and endoscopic instrument sets, to ensure they are always in good working order and ready for use.Follow procedures for the review and inspection of medical instrumentation, and document related work.Work with the Account Executives and Regional Sales Managers to displace competitive products from the account.Work as a consultant with the Account Executives and Regional Sales Managers to aid in the promotion and sale of containers and trays that accompany our devices.Minimize customer equipment downtime by completing tasks in a timely and effective manner.Provide high quality service to customers for installation, repair and maintenance of hardware and/or software products.Ensure a high level of customer satisfaction in a fast paced and challenging work environment, often under stressful conditions.Complete fields reports, repair order sign off, administrative tasks and expense reports in a timely manner.Support the service, sales, marketing, operations, logistics, and finance teams to meet the service objective of Quality and Service Excellence to exceed customer expectations.Attend regular Technical Training Courses at KARL STORZ training facilities in the U.S and Europe.Other responsibilities and services as assigned by the Manager, Tender and Service Management.K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S & ABILITIES:Outstanding electronic, electrical, and mechanical skills and knowledge.Networking and computer-related service skills and knowledge.Brilliant troubleshooting skills.Ability to read, understand and follow Quality System documentation.Good organizational skills.Basic software skills required including basic proficiency with Microsoft Office.Excellent verbal and written communication. Ability to read, write, speak and understand the English language; French-speaking and written skills are an asset.Ability to manage and maintain confidential and proprietary information.Maintains ability to lift up to 50 lbs.Must maintain a clean and valid driver’s license.Must maintain a valid Passport.Flexibility to work a variety of schedules including nights, weekends, and holidays.Ability to take assignments on short notice.Occasional travel, both domestic or international, as required, up to approximately 40% of the time.Experience with networking/IP based systems an asset.Bilingualism is an asset.QUALIFICATIONSEducated to degree level is preferable with experience in at least one of the following: Electrical/Mechanical Engineering, Medical Physics, Service and maintenance of medical equipmentThe ideal candidate will have minimum 3 to 5 years of experience in a relevant job function within the medical industry.Internal applicants with an equivalent combination of education, experience and performance over time at KARL STORZ will be considered.
